Conexión de programas COBOL a Oracle Database 11g Express en Windows 10
Para establecer una conexión desde un programa COBOL a Oracle Database 11g Express en Windows 10, debes utilizar un enfoque que involucre el uso de un controlador de base de datos adecuado y proporcionar la información de conexión necesaria, como el nombre de usuario, la contraseña y la dirección IP del servidor. A continuación, te guiaré a través de los pasos generales para lograrlo:
1. Obtén el controlador de base de datos de Oracle:
- Lo primero que necesitas hacer es asegurarte de que tienes instalado un controlador de base de datos adecuado para Oracle en tu sistema. Puedes utilizar el controlador ODBC (Open Database Connectivity) o JDBC (Java Database Connectivity) dependiendo de tus preferencias y de la disponibilidad de herramientas en COBOL.
2. Configura el controlador:
- Configura el controlador de base de datos Oracle en tu sistema. Esto implica especificar el nombre de usuario, la contraseña y la dirección IP o el nombre del servidor al que deseas conectarte. La forma exacta de hacerlo dependerá del controlador que estés utilizando.
3. Crea la conexión en tu programa COBOL:
- En tu programa COBOL, deberás utilizar las bibliotecas y funciones proporcionadas por el controlador de base de datos para establecer una conexión. Esto generalmente implica definir una sección de control en tu programa COBOL y utilizar sentencias específicas del controlador para conectarte a la base de datos.
4. Ejecuta consultas y actualizaciones:
- Una vez que la conexión se haya establecido con éxito, podrás ejecutar consultas SQL y realizar actualizaciones en la base de datos Oracle desde tu programa COBOL. Puedes usar sentencias SQL incorporadas en tu código COBOL o llamar a procedimientos almacenados en la base de datos.
5. Maneja errores y cierre de conexión:
- Asegúrate de manejar los errores de conexión y de cierre de manera adecuada en tu programa COBOL para garantizar que la conexión se libere correctamente cuando hayas terminado de trabajar con la base de datos.
6. Pruebas y depuración:
- Realiza pruebas exhaustivas en tu programa COBOL para asegurarte de que la conexión y las operaciones en la base de datos funcionen como se espera. Utiliza herramientas de depuración si es necesario para identificar y corregir problemas.
Ten en cuenta que los detalles específicos pueden variar según el controlador de base de datos y la biblioteca COBOL que estés utilizando. Asegúrate de consultar la documentación correspondiente a tu entorno de desarrollo para obtener información detallada sobre cómo realizar la conexión y las operaciones de base de datos en COBOL.